Limp Bizkit's fourth studio album, Results May Vary , released on September 23, 2003, remains one of the most polarizing releases in nu-metal history. For audiophiles and collectors, high-resolution versions—including 24-bit FLAC releases—provide a deeper look into a production that was both experimental and fraught with internal tension.
